What Are Custom Foam Inserts?

Custom foam inserts are protective foam structures designed to fit perfectly within the compartments of a case, providing safe storage for individual items. By customizing the foam layout, users can secure items in such a way that minimizes movement and protects them from shock, vibration, and environmental hazards. These inserts are essential for professionals who depend on their equipment being transported safely without compromise, ensuring everything is organized and accessible.

Types of Foam Materials Available

Understanding the different types of foam materials is crucial when designing custom inserts. The most commonly used foams include:

  • Polyurethane Foam: Lightweight and versatile, providing excellent cushioning.
  • EVA Foam: Known for its toughness and resistance to environmental factors, suitable for rugged applications.
  • Closed-Cell Foam: Water-resistant and offers superior buoyancy, ideal for aquatic environments.
  • Open-Cell Foam: Offers breathability and lightweight properties, although less protective than closed-cell options.

Measuring Your Pelican Case

Precision is vital when measuring your Pelican case. Use a tape measure to determine the internal dimensions, paying close attention to corners and handles, as these can affect the fit of your foam insert. Accurate measurements will help you avoid issues related to sizing.

Customization Options and Tips

Customization options can include designing cutouts for specific equipment, adding multiple layers for different items, or integrating a convoluted foam layer to provide cushioning and noise reduction. Remember to consider how the design influences visibility and accessibility of your gear.

Cleaning and Maintaining Your Foam

To prolong the life of foam inserts, regular cleaning and maintenance are necessary. Use a mild detergent and damp cloth for spot cleaning. Avoid using chemicals as they can degrade the foam material. Ensure the insert is thoroughly dried before reinstalling it into the case.

Extending the Life of Custom Foam Inserts

To extend the lifespan of your custom foam inserts, avoid overloading the Pelican case, and store it in a climate-controlled environment. Regular inspections for wear and tear can help catch issues early and maintain the integrity of the foam.
